Gallery: Tenth Annual LMUD Student Art Calendar Awards

2014calendartop620Winning entries in the 2014 LMUD Art Calendar contest were announced, and the winners were honored, at a ceremony held late Friday afternoon in the LMUD board room.

The annual calendar is celebrating it’s tenth year of spreading the important theme ‘Stay Clear and Stay Alive!‘ illustrated with artwork created by local students.

Kids were asked to submit artwork showing the importance of electrical safety and how to avoid trouble in dangerous situations. 12 submissions were chosen by a panel of judges to be featured in the pages of the 2014 calendar.

Featured in this year’s calendar will be artwork by Reesha and Damian Wynters from Juniper Ridge, Zane and Marcus Owen from Richmond Elementary, Josie and Jenna Leaman from Shaffer Elementary, Kindergartner Christian Henry from Richmond, Zoe Cosette Robinson from Westwood Charter School, Rylie Pizzola from Janesville, Emmalee Rotlisberger from Richmond, Nadia Castrejon and Yves Santa both from Juniper Ridge.

The winning students each received an award certificate and a gift card presented by LMUD Board Vice-President Richard Vial.

Calendars will be available to pick up at the first of the year.
